Perfect Square
2410072142346835186548960801 is a perfect square (49092485599599 × 49092485599599)
2410072142346835186548960801 is a perfect square (49092485599599 × 49092485599599)
2410072142346835186548960801 is odd
Previous odd number is 2410072142346835186548960799
Next odd number is 2410072142346835186548960803
1111100100110010000101000001010000100000011101000010001111011011010010100110110111000100001
13998778067523002442945424461347456339697520369156735137002974697611138083168802401